About the Department/Team

The Global Ethics Office (GEO) mitigates conflicts of interest and ensures employee compliance with regional policies related to personal account dealing, outside business activities, gifts and entertainment, and political contributions.

About the Role

The Compliance Officer monitors employee compliance with the Code of Ethics and Personal Trading Policy, the Global Outside Business Activities policy, the Global Political Contributions policy and regional Gifts and Entertainment policies through Star Compliance, the Service Now Global Ethics Office Support Portal, and conversing with employees directly. This position will primarily support North American employees.

Responsibilities
  • Provide education to Invesco North America employees by answering their questions and concerns around personal trading, outside business activities, political contributions, and gifts and entertainment.
  • Coordinate and support small- to mid-sized projects, ensuring effective planning, stakeholder alignment, and timely delivery of compliance-related initiatives.
  • Monitor employee completion of reports from time to time as required by policy, including submission of initial/annual acknowledgement forms, brokerage account listings, initial/annual holdings reports, and quarterly transaction reports.
  • Review personal trading pre-clearance requests to determine if it should be approved or denied based on the personal trading policy using the Star Compliance Employee Conflicts of Interest system.
  • Conduct post-trade monitoring of all personal securities transactions to verify compliance with the trading policy.
  • Conduct investigations of conduct that violates the Code of Ethics and Personal Trading Policy, the Global Outside Business Activities policy, the Global Political Contributions policy and regional Gifts and Entertainment policies by any employee and issue letters of education as required.
  • Perform other tasks as needed.
